I use Logitech Harmony remotes, a Model 880 for my main TV that that feeds sound to my receiver. It can control up to 8 devices and send multiple commands to the different devices with one button press. For example, to watch satellite TV you can power on the TV, the satellite box, and the receiver, then switch inputs on either the TV or the receiver. It's discontinued but replaced by the Model 650 which sells on Amazon for $66. You would also need an infrared extender to send commands to the equipment in the closet, probably around fifty bucks. The transmitter receives the infrared commands and relays them by RF to the receiver in the closet which converts them back to infrared.

Logitech maintains an extensive library of devices and lets you tweak which buttons to use, etc. You can also do custom commands that will appear on the screen of the remote.
